DJ Khaled Announces New Album, ‘I Changed a Lot,’ Out Next Week

“We the best.” “We takin’ over.” “Another one.” “I changed a lot.” DJ Khaled’s coined sayings on sayings, and he’s turning that last one into a new album — I Changed a Lot — due next week (October 23). Stacked with guests — Jeremih, Future, John Legend, Fetty Wap, Jay Z, and more — the LP’s already got two singles out: “You Mine” and “Gold Slugs.” Check out the tracks, as well as the full I Changed a Lot track list, below.

DJ Khaled, I Changed a Lot track list:
1. “I Don’t Play About My Paper” feat. Future & Rick Ross
2. “I Ride” feat. Boosie Badazz, Future, Rick Ross & Jeezy
3. “Gold Slugs” feat. Chris Brown, August Alsina & Fetty Wap
4. “I Swear I Never Tell Another Soul” feat. Future, Yo Gotti & Trick Daddy
5. “I Lied” feat. French Montana, Meek Mill, Beanie Sigel & Jadakiss
6. “How Many Times” feat. Chris Brown, Lil’ Wayne & Big Sean
7. “You Mine” feat. Trey Songz, Jeremih & Future
8. “Every Time We Come Around” feat. French Montana, Jadakiss, Ace Hood & Vado
9. “I Ain’t Worried” feat. Ace Hood & Rick Ross
10. “They Don’t Love You No More” feat. Jay Z, Meek Mill, Rick Ross & French Montana
11. “My League” feat. Mavado
12. “Hold You Down” feat. Chris Brown, August Alsina, Future & Jeremih
13. “Most High” feat. John Legend
